Introduction


Choosing the right type of fence is a big decision for any homeowner. Two of the most popular fencing materials are aluminum and wood—but which one is better for your needs? In this blog, we’ll compare aluminum and wood fences based on durability, cost, maintenance, aesthetics, and more. By the end, you’ll have a clear idea of what works best for your home or business in Virginia or Maryland.




1. Durability



  • Aluminum Fences
    Extremely durable and resistant to rust, corrosion, and weather damage. Ideal for humid or rainy climates like parts of Virginia.

  • Wood Fences
    Naturally strong but vulnerable to rot, pests, and weather damage over time—especially without regular maintenance.


Winner: Aluminum




2. Maintenance



  • Aluminum
    Virtually maintenance-free. No painting, staining, or sealing required. Occasional cleaning with soap and water is enough.

  • Wood
    Requires regular upkeep—staining or painting every few years and checking for rot or termite damage.


Winner: Aluminum




3. Aesthetics



  • Aluminum
    Sleek and modern. Comes in various styles and colors, including black powder-coated finishes for a high-end look.

  • Wood
    Offers natural beauty and charm. Can be painted or stained in any color and customized for a rustic or classic appearance.


Winner: Tie (Depends on your style preference)




4. Privacy



  • Aluminum
    Typically designed with open spaces between bars. Great for security and visibility, but not for full privacy.

  • Wood
    Excellent for privacy. You can install solid panels that completely block the view from outside.


Winner: Wood




5. Cost



  • Aluminum
    Higher upfront cost but low maintenance means fewer long-term expenses.

  • Wood
    Generally cheaper to install, but long-term maintenance can make it more expensive over time.


Winner: Depends on your budget goals




6. Installation Time



  • Aluminum
    Pre-fabricated panels are quicker to install.

  • Wood
    Takes longer due to customization and staining/sealing work.


Winner: Aluminum




Conclusion: Which Fence Should You Choose?



  • Choose Aluminum if you want a low-maintenance, durable, and modern-looking fence.

  • Choose Wood if you prefer natural beauty, privacy, and a traditional feel.
